Englebert Kaempfer (1651-1716) was a surgeon working for the Dutch East India Company (VOC) who is responsible for writing the one of the most comprehensive European accounts of Japan, published posthumously in English by Sir Hans Sloane in 1727 (RCIN 1074485-6). This book was the only text he managed to publish in his lifetime. It provides an overview of the medicinal plants and surgical techniques used in medicine in Iran, Thailand and Japan where he travelled during his service with the VOC. The text provides the first botany of Japanese plants to be published in Europe.
